Course Details

Introduction to Green Technology and Biofuels: Understanding the basics of green technology and the importance of biofuels in the current energy landscape.

Biofuel Production Processes: Exploring the various methods and technologies used to produce biofuels such as biochemical conversion, thermochemical conversion, and mechanical extraction.

Biofuel Efficiency and Performance: Examining the efficiency and performance of different types of biofuels, including biodiesel, bioethanol, and biogas, in comparison to traditional fossil fuels.

Biofuel Policy and Regulations: Reviewing global and local policies, regulations, and standards related to biofuel production and use.

Sustainability and Environmental Impact of Biofuels: Investigating the environmental impact of biofuel production, including land use change, greenhouse gas emissions, and biodiversity loss.

Emerging Technologies in Biofuel Production: Exploring the latest advancements and innovations in biofuel production, such as algae-based biofuels, synthetic biology, and biorefineries.

Supply Chain Management in Biofuel Industry: Understanding the complexities and challenges of managing a biofuel supply chain, from feedstock production to distribution and sales.

Economics of Biofuel Production: Analyzing the economic feasibility and profitability of biofuel production, including the impact of government subsidies, market demand, and commodity prices.

Leadership and Change Management in Green Technology: Developing leadership and change management skills to drive the adoption of green technology and biofuels in organizations.
